Connection terminals for the PI-EX series:
- Ex PI-ES-TB: Ex basic connection terminal for intrinsically safe signals with knife disconnection and test connections.
- Ex PI-ES-TB: Ex basic connection terminal with knife disconnection and integrated temperature measurement of the input connection terminals for cold spot compensation.
- Ex TT-PI-EX-TB/T: Intrinsically safe basic connection terminal with insulating connector, test connections, and overvoltage protection, with additional temperature measurement of the input connection terminal for cold spot compensation, for mounting on NS 35/7.5.
- Ex TT-PI-EX-TB: Intrinsically safe basic terminal block with insulating connector, test connections, and overvoltage protection, for mounting on NS 35/7.5.
